b'DAD\'S ARMY - The unmistakable voice of Bud Flanagan singing \'Who Do You Think You Are Kidding, Mr Hitler?\', a cod-Second World War propaganda singalong written especially for the show (by Jimmy Perry), introduced Dad\'s Army, the zenith of the British broad-comedy ensemble sitcom. Consistently good writing and a wonderful cast of old timers and newer talents combined to produce a whimsical period-piece that continues, justifiably, to be savoured and has now assumed a place in the \'hall of greats\' pantheon, adored by new generations of the British public.

THIS EPISODE:
Sgt. Wilson\'s Little Secret (11-15-68)

When Mrs Pike tells Pike there is a little Arthur on the way, having taken in an evacuee, (Arthur) Wilson gets worried and assumes that it is his child, and begins to plan a wedding.
